Top Networking Equipment for Podcasting PCs

1. Routers

A high-performance router is the backbone of your network. For podcasting, look for routers that support the latest Wi-Fi standards, such as Wi-Fi 6 (802.11ax), offering faster speeds and better handling of multiple devices. Features like Quality of Service (QoS) help prioritize your streaming and recording traffic.

  • Netgear Nighthawk AX12: Supports Wi-Fi 6, multiple streams, and advanced QoS.
  • Asus RT-AX88U: Offers excellent speed, security features, and user-friendly interface.
  • TP-Link Archer AX6000: Great coverage and high-speed connectivity.

2. Network Switches

If your setup involves multiple wired devices, a reliable network switch is essential. It expands your wired network, providing stable, high-speed connections for microphones, external drives, and other peripherals.

  • Netgear GS308: Compact, reliable, and easy to set up.
  • TP-Link TL-SG108: Affordable and offers gigabit speeds.
  • Cisco SG250-08: Suitable for more advanced setups with managed features.

3. Network Adapters and Wi-Fi Extenders

If your PC does not have the latest Wi-Fi capabilities, consider adding a high-quality network adapter or Wi-Fi extender to improve connectivity, especially in larger rooms or complex setups.

  • TP-Link Archer T4U Plus: Dual-band Wi-Fi USB adapter with strong performance.
  • NETGEAR Nighthawk Mesh Extender: Extends Wi-Fi coverage and maintains speed.

Additional Tips for a Robust Networking Setup

To optimize your networking for podcasting:

  • Place your router centrally to ensure even coverage.
  • Use wired connections whenever possible for critical devices.
  • Secure your network with strong passwords and encryption.
  • Regularly update firmware for all networking devices.
  • Implement network segmentation to prioritize podcasting traffic.
